YAML (YAML Ain't Markup Language) is a human-readable data serialization format commonly used for configuration files, automation, and application settings.

Converting CSV to YAML makes spreadsheet data suitable for configuration files, DevOps tools, static site generators, and modern software development workflows.

YAML is used by Kubernetes, Docker Compose, Ansible, GitHub Actions, GitLab CI, Jekyll, Hugo, Netlify CMS, and many other development and automation tools.
